Explanation

An X-Play Trigger is a condition that initiates a Playbook. There are four types of X-Play Triggers: Alert, Audit, Event, and Time. An Alert Trigger is based on a Prism alert, such as a VM power state change or a disk failure. An Audit Trigger is based on a Prism audit entry, such as a user login or a cluster operation. An Event Trigger is based on a Prism event, such as a VM creation or deletion. A Time Trigger is based on a schedule, such as daily, weekly, or monthly. In this scenario, the administrator needs to create a Playbook to be notified when VMs are deleted.
